WHEREAS, the City of Denton, Texas, is concerned with the development of viable urban communities including decent housing, a suitable living environment and expanded economic opportunities; and WHEREAS, the City of Denton, Texas, has a special concern for persons of low and very low income; and WHEREAS, the City of Denton, Texas, as a CDBG entitlement city, wishes to participate in a grant application with the City of Fort Worth under the Lead:Based Paint Hazard Control Grant Program, under Section 1011 of the Residential Lead-Based Hazard Reduction Act of 1992 (Title X of the Housing and Community Development Act of 1992) and all other applicable laws, which will include approximately $250,000 for lead hazard control activities within the City of Denton; and WHEREAS, in carrying out these activities, the City of Denton, Texas, intends to comply with Section 3 of the Housing and Urban Development Act of 1968, 12 U.S.C. l70l(u) and will provide training, employment and other economic opportunity for low and very low income persons (as defined in 24 C.F.R. 135.5) and for business concerns which provide economic opportunity for low and very low income person; and WHEREAS, the primary goal for the Lead-Based Paint Hazard Control Grant Program is to reduce the exposure of young children to lead-based paint hazards in their home; and WHEREAS, the City of Denton, Texas has met or will meet all citizen participation requirements, if any, including the holding of public hearings; and WHEREAS, the City Council deems it in the public interest to authorize the City Manager to participate with the City of Fort Worth in the development and submission of the grant application; NOW, THEREFORE, TH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F DENTON HEREBY RESOLVES: S:\Our Documents\Community Dev-Housing Authodty\Ordinances-ResoluÜons\05\Lead based paint grunt res.DOC SECTION 1. That the City Council of the City of Denton, Texas, authorizes the City Manager to participate in a joint grant submission with the City of Fort Worth to submit to the United States Department of Housing and Urban Development and all appropriate officials thereof, all necessary certifications, grant agreements and other documents as well as appropriate assurances for entitlement of funds under the Housing and Community Development Act of 1974, as amended, and the National Affordable Housing Act of 1990, as amended, and all other applicable laws, as necessary, to obtain a grant under the Lead-Based Paint Hazard Control Grant Program. SECTION 2. That the City Council authorizes and directs the City Manager, or his designee, to represent and act on behalf of the City of Denton in applying for and working with the City of Fort Worth and the United States Department of Housing and Urban Development, in regard to such grant application.
